Emergency services / Emergency services called out overnight

EMERGENCY services were tasked in the early hours of the morning (Saturday) following reports of a missing person.

The Sumburgh based search and rescue helicopter, coastguard rescue teams the Lerwick Lifeboat assessed the police, with the focus on the coastline from the Knab in Lerwick to Gulberwick.

The person was traced around five hours after the alarm was raised.

Lerwick Lifeboat’s deputy coxswain Tommy Goudie said: “We’re pleased that the missing person was eventually traced, despite our search efforts and those of emergency services colleagues. Our volunteer crew are always ready to respond to a request to launch whenever we might be able to assist.”
